WebHow to apply border to an element on mouse hover without affecting the layout in CSS - By default if you apply the border around an element on mouse hover it will move the surrounding elements from its original position. However using the negative CSS margin value and a little trick you can do it nicely without affecting the other elements or content. WebOct 13, 2024 · Let's add a scale transform property to add scale transition to the element. .elem:hover { transform: scale (1.1); } But the transition doesn't seem to be smooth, because we didn't define the duration of the transition or use any timing function. If we add the transition property, it will make the element move more smoothly.

The syntax requirements for the :hover selector are as follows: selector:hover {style} The selector can be defined in three ways: using the name of the element. using the ID of the element. using a certain class. Example. p:hover, h1:hover, a:hover { background-color: yellow; } imcom fort campbell
